Door and window repair services involve fixing or restoring existing doors and windows to ensure they function properly and look their best. This can include tasks such as replacing broken glass, repairing damaged frames, fixing sticking or difficult-to-open doors and windows, and addressing issues with locks or hinges. These repairs help improve the overall security, energy efficiency, and appearance of a property, making sure that doors and windows operate smoothly and safely.
Many common problems lead homeowners to seek door and window repair services. For example, windows may become drafty or difficult to open due to warping or broken hardware, while doors might stick or fail to latch properly because of misalignment or damaged components. Cracked or shattered glass can pose safety hazards and reduce insulation, while damaged frames can compromise the structural integrity of the opening. Repairing these issues helps prevent further damage and restores the functionality and aesthetic appeal of the property.

The overview below groups typical Door Window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rancho Santa Margarita,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s like replacing a cracked window pane or fixing a damaged lock generally range from $150 to $400. Many common j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the specific repair needs and window type.
Medium-Size Projects - Replacing multiple windows or upgrading to energy-efficient models us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500. Larger, more complex projects can reach higher amounts but are less common for standard repairs.
Full Window Replacement - Replacing an entire window unit, including frames, can cost from $500 to $1,200 per window.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, though larger or custom installations may be more expensive.
Large or Custom Projects - Extensive window or door replacements, especially for custom designs or large openings, can exceed $5,000. Fewer projects fall into this high-cost tier, which typically involves complex installations or premium mater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
